JOB DESCRIPTIONKeppel is a global asset manager and operator headquartered in Singapore. With operations in more than 20 countries worldwide, we provide innovative solutions that address some of the world’s most pressing needs across the energy transition, rapid urbanisation, and increasing digitalisation. This role sits within 1 of the 2 platforms: (i) Fund Management and (ii) Investment. The Fund Management platform focuses on raising capital and forging stronger relationships with investors. The Investment platform aims to drive capital deployment decisions and horizontal integration to create value for our investors. Together, we aim to create value and deliver sustainable returns for our investors through a range of products including listed REITs and business trusts and private funds which invests globally into real estate, infrastructure, data centres and alternative asset classes.
